Lucid Group (LCID) announced that Silvio Napoli will be Lucid’s next CEO and will join Lucid’s Board of Directors. Napoli is currently based in Switzerland and will be relocating to the U.S. Interim CEO Marc Winterhoff will serve as Lucid’s COO upon Napoli assuming the CEO role. Napoli brings decades of global industrial leadership experience, most recently serving as Chairman and CEO of Schindler Group, one of the world’s leading industrial technology companies.
